Tanguá has a warm climate with an average annual temperature of 75°F (24°C). Winters average 78°F in January while summers reach 68°F in July / relatively mild seasonal variation. The area gets 305 sunny days per year, well above the U.S. average of 205 / making it one of the sunnier locations in the country. Annual precipitation totals 79.7 inches (wetter than the 38-inch national average). The city sits at an elevation of 98 feet.

Monthly Weather

Month Avg Temperature Precipitation Summary
January 78°F (25°C) 6.1 in
February 78°F (26°C) 6.8 in Warmest
March 77°F (25°C) 7.4 in Wettest
April 74°F (23°C) 5.2 in
May 70°F (21°C) 3.0 in
June 68°F (20°C) 1.8 in
July 68°F (20°C) 1.4 in Coldest
August 69°F (20°C) 0.9 in Driest
September 70°F (21°C) 1.3 in
October 72°F (22°C) 2.7 in
November 74°F (23°C) 3.4 in
December 76°F (24°C) 5.2 in

Tanguá has a seasonal temperature swing of 11°F / from 68°F in July to 78°F in February. Total annual precipitation is 45.2 inches, with March being the wettest month (7.4") and August the driest (0.9").
